TROS and De Telegraaf settle disputes
De Vereniging TROS (TROS) and N.V. Holdingmaatschappij De Telegraaf (De Telegraaf) have decided to settle their disputes and cease litigation.
The disputes were occasioned by TROS withdrawing the running of its listings magazines TROSKompas and TV-krant from De Telegraaf as of 1 January 1997. De Telegraaf took the view that agreement had already been reached on a renewed partnership for the running of the magazines. TROS considered that De Telegraaf had been overcharging it for many years.
As time went by, the parties increasingly came to the conclusion that the legal battle was costing them a lot of time and energy. Following a number of searching discussions they decided to end their law suits. They are now looking to the future again and talking about possible collaboration, e.g. in the area of the Internet.
